Berith is derived from a root which means to cut, and hence a covenant is a cutting, with reference to the cutting or dividing of animals into two parts, and the contracting parties passing between them, in making a covenant genesis 15. The covenant with black america is a 2006 political, nonfiction book edited by the american talkshow host and writer tavis smiley.
